Criteria

The "Introduction to Mindfulness" course is an evidence-based program designed to teach practical tools for reducing stress, improving focus, and enhancing self-awareness. The program runs for four weeks, and classes are 75 minutes in length. The badge recipient successfully completed this course, utilizing mindfulness and meditation techniques for stress relief, as well as strategies to boost focus and emotional resilience. They have developed essential skills to navigate the unique challenges of student life and have laid a strong foundation for building their professional identity.

Earning Criteria:

Attendance & Participation

  • Attend at least 75% of all group sessions
  • Actively engage in group discussions, reflections, and mindfulness/meditation exercises

Practice Commitment

  • Complete a minimum of 5-30 minutes of daily meditation practice, tracked via a journal or app
  • Daily mindfulness activity and gratitude practice
  • Submit a personal reflection log or mindfulness journal

Learning Integration

  • Complete all assigned readings, practice prompts, or exercises
  • Demonstrate understanding of key concepts:
  • Mindfulness foundations
  • Emotional regulation
  • Self-awareness and stress response
  • Compassion-based practices

Reflection / Evaluation

  • Submit a final evaluation
  • Highlight personal growth during the program
  • Key insights gained
  • Intentions for continued practice

Ethical Engagement

  • Participate in a respectful, inclusive, and nonjudgmental manner
  • Uphold confidentiality and group agreements
